That would be the right answer Z. Just remove the 3 small bolts and adjust
the washers for correct tension. Just be careful about not removing the rear
part of the pulley and screwing up the location of your timing marks.

To be more clear...
the BAN (big assed nut) does not need to come off to swap washers in and out
to adjust belt tension. Just the 3 small bolts. The only time the BAN needs
to come off is to remove the flange that the pully is bolted to. No
necessary unless you want to remove the timing gear cover.


 After my years with BMW manuals I find the Eldo shop manual a bit sparse in
places.
I'd like to know if I can pull the front of the pulley and generator belt
to adjust washers and stuff without removing tank, loossening generator and
taking the belt off that way first.
Can someone walk me through the steps please.
I assume loosening the crank nut involves having the bike in first gear,
someone'
s foot on the brake and a fairly healthy sized extension to a breaker bar.
Can I then just remove the three nuts on the pulley and use a puller to get
it off.
Can I replace the pulley in reverse with it still being on the generator
pulley.
Thanks folks.
